Free: Santa Anita horses to watch for week of Jan. 2, 2023
I’M A GAMBLER
Trainer: Mark Glatt
Last race: Dec. 26, race 1
Finish: Fourth by two lengths
Beyer: 87
Inconclusive U.S. debut by import in turf stake. Saved ground, blocked quarter pole into lane, then delivered no kick. Willing to give another shot vs. similar stakes rivals.
FAUSTIN
Trainer: Bob Baffert
Last race: Dec. 26, race 4
Finish: First by two and three-quarter lengths
Beyer: 87
Debut colt by Curlin good enough to win first out at six furlongs. Outrun and shuffled slightly, took dirt, angled outside, going away. Promising 3-year-old colt for 2023.
YELLOW BRICK
Trainer: Richard Mandella
Last race: Dec. 26, race 4
Finish: Third by six and one-quarter lengths
Beyer: 75
Quality Road colt wants to route; ran well in debut sprint. Lagged off pace, finished evenly, solid prep race. Follow when stretches to mile and sixteenth in early 2023.
MALTESE FALCON
Trainer: Leonard Powell
Last race: Dec. 26, race 5
Finish: Fourth by two and one-half lengths
Beyer: 64
European import ran super in maiden turf mile. Keen, unrelaxed behind runners first half-mile, in traffic far turn, kicked late, 23.06 final quarter. Follow in maiden race.
JEWELLED SHILLEELAGH
Trainer: Michael McCarthy
Last race: Dec. 30, race 5
Finish: Sixth by three lengths
Beyer: 68
Maiden colt racing into shape. Keen in turf mile, rail trip third, seemed to lose interest into the lane, then re-rallied. Strange trip by 3yo still learning the game.
TEA N CONVERSATION
Trainer: Michael McCarthy
Last race: Dec. 30, race 9
Finish: Fourth by two and one-quarter lengths
Beyer: 70
This filly ran super in turf stake. Far back in mile race dominated by speed, smoked final quarter in 23.30, wants longer. Set up for solid 3-year-old campaign in 2023.
BOLD ENDEAVOR
Trainer: Peter Miller
Last race: Dec. 31, race 2
Finish: First by nose
Beyer: 91
Veteran dropped to $50k claiming and returned to peak form in fast dirt mile. Claimed by Miller from Mark Glatt, can repeat in similar allowance/optional claiming route.
TIO MAGICO
Trainer: Phil D’Amato
Last race: Jan. 2, race 10
Finish: fourth by two and three-quarter lengths
Beyer: 84
Entry-level allowance turf-route gelding did not have a fair shot as favorite. Steadied early, trapped inside and behind runners, waited and waited, finished well, too late.
